How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Blawenburg?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Blawenburg Studio Apartments | $2,534 | $1,395 | $3,065 |
Blawenburg 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,763 | $710 | $4,630 |
Blawenburg 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,541 | $852 | $6,779 |
Blawenburg 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,226 | $984 | $6,329 |

Getting Around Blawenburg, NJ
Walk Score®
25 / 100
Car-Dependent
Most errands require a car
Bike Score®
28 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
